Buriti Palm Fruit

The Buriti palm fruit is a nutrient-rich tropical fruit known for its high content of vitamins A and C, as well as healthy fats. It is often used in traditional medicine and culinary applications in South America.

Rich in beta-carotene, which is converted to vitamin A in the body, supporting vision and immune function.
Contains healthy fats that can help improve heart health and provide energy.

American Plum

The American plum is a small, sweet fruit native to North America, known for its juicy flesh and vibrant color. It is rich in vitamins and antioxidants, making it a nutritious addition to the diet.

Rich in antioxidants, American plums help combat oxidative stress and may reduce the risk of chronic diseases.
High in dietary fiber, they support digestive health and can aid in weight management.
